Lowering thick plants is a critical aspect of landscape management, helping to bring back order, enhance aesthetics, and promote plant health. Overgrowth can restrict air flow, reduce sunlight penetration, and create opportunities for bugs and disease. Pruning and thinning are the primary methods for managing thick or unruly plant life, permitting plants to prosper while maintaining a regulated look. The process includes selectively getting rid of excess branches, stems, and foliage, constantly considering the natural development routine of each types. Timing is essential; some plants respond best to pruning during inactivity, while blooming ranges may require post-bloom cutting to maintain blossoms. Correct method ensures cuts are tidy and located to motivate healthy brand-new growth. In addition to enhancing plant health, decreasing overgrowth improves accessibility and visibility in the landscape Paths, driveways, and outside living spaces become more secure and more inviting. Long-term upkeep strategies prevent future overgrowth, guaranteeing a balanced and unified landscape.
